Mount Hope, Alabama Climate and Weather
Current Weather in Mount Hope
In the month of December, Mount Hope experiences an average high temperature of 54 degrees Fahrenheit. Low temperaturs in December are usually about 34 degrees with an average rainfall of 5.85 inches. The seasonal climate varies in Mount Hope with daytime temperatures averaging 88 degrees in the summer, and 54 degrees in the winter months. Visitors can also expect Mount Hope to receive an average of 5.57 inches of rainfall per/month during winter months and 3.92 inches of rainfall per/month in the summer months. The temperature has been known to get as high as 106 degrees in the summer and as low as -13 degrees in the winter so visitors planning a vacation to Mount Hope should check the weather forecast to determine proper attire prior to departure. Alabama Music Hall of Fame - Tuscumbia, The Alabama Music Hall of Fame, first conceived by the Muscle Shoals Music Association in the early 1980s, was created by the Alabama Music Hall of Fame Board, which then saw to its Phase One construction of a 12,500 sq ft after a state-wide referendum in 1987. It currently stands in the town of Tuscumbia, Alabama.

Belle Mont (Tuscumbia, Alabama) - Tuscumbia, Belle Mont is a historic Jeffersonian-style plantation house near Tuscumbia in Colbert County, Alabama. It was added to the National Register of Historic Places on February 23, 1982, due to its architectural significance.

Ivy Green - Tuscumbia, Ivy Green is the name for the childhood home of Helen Keller. It is located in Tuscumbia, Alabama. The house was built in 1820 and is a simple white clapboard house. The actual well pump where Helen Keller first communicated with Anne Sullivan is located at Ivy Green.

Joseph Wheeler Plantation - Hillsboro, The Joseph Wheeler Plantation, commonly known as Pond Spring or the General Joe Wheeler Home, is a historic plantation complex and historic district in the Tennessee River Valley in Wheeler, Alabama. The property contains twelve historically significant structures dating from 1818 to the 1880s. It was added to the National Register of Historic Places on April 13, 1977, due to its association with Joseph Wheeler.
